Output d3b1f90d791437ebd46e8e865156c4e21bff372b1de3f60bf5f16ea7f997a942:3

value
887376276
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 575a4bb3e9722e4dd6e70a15546cb306954f898d OP_EQUALVERIFY OP_CHECKSIG
address
18xsxYdsNSM3bTKnqQsKFZWzsBg6gNFJRW
transaction
d3b1f90d791437ebd46e8e865156c4e21bff372b1de3f60bf5f16ea7f997a942
spent
true